The final resting place of Margaret Cooper is at the south side of Memphis Memorial Park, in a corner east of the entrance fountain.

Centenarian Margaret Cooper was twice a widow, and met her first husband on a blind date!

Her obituary can be read on the findagrave memorial: (visit link)

Text on headstone:

Margaret Clack
Askew Hood Cooper
October 8, 1911
September 28, 2014
